fair enough warren, that set up, 16g comp. with the smaller td04 turbine, does make more sense, but you then are getting into a hybrid turbo! that can change costs.
steve,, remember most XJS have automatic trans, so finding the turbo sweet spot can be a little interesting, manual you can drop into a gear where you know it can boost quickly.
warren, compressor surge is way over rated, have built many, that the guys actually like the rump-rump surge sound, never lost a turbo, surge worries are more for constant rpm when turb is held in the surge zone for long periods of time.
and here in USA, many LS series have been turbod, an LS 5.3 has much more exhaust energy than a jag 5.3. exhaust energy is what spins the turbine.

I have researched the F1 turbos and they used to run quite small turbine housings with massive compressors and then use a very LARGE wastegate to bypassed exhaust gas this 1) controled boost creep and 2) reduced exhaust back pressure up top.
This is what I ws thinking - 2 stock TD04's from a WRX/Volvo/Saab, I can upgrade the compressor housing later. As I said I can pick up 2 of these for around $60 each in good condition and the upgraded 16g compressor housing and wheel for $150 each, there are so many on the second hand market here as the Subaru WRX is plentiful. The Mitsubishi also come standard with WC bearings, this is a must have. The cheapest I can get a T28 is around $400 each.
I had a Subaru WRX with the TD04 and the 2.0L struggled above 5500rpm, not enough compressor flow, the Volvo V70 T5 also has this turbo with a 16G compressor which was a much better deal on the 2.3L. I only used the TD05's as I could not find a TD04 16G and 20G map.
Why I was concerned about suge was that have seen a Toyota Supra detonate a turbo in under 30seconds on a dyno due to surge.

Oddly enough, I plan to do exactly what you have in mind on my V12 test stand in order to avoid all of the complexity required with the FI setup. I only want to run an engine with some of the mods I do in order to check things out before installing in a car. A couple years back, there was a person on ebay who actually made some very good looking intake manifolds for two four barrel carbs for the 5.3L V12. My issue with the set up was the smallest carbs available are the 450 cfm Holley which would total 900 cfm. The engine would have to be highly modified to run well with that much carb and driveability may be iffy on the street. I have a friend with a cobra replica which has a highly modified 351C with a Holley Dominator which is around 1000cfm and at any other mode other than WOT, you could run a Ford Pinto on the exhaust. A couple of Holley two barrels might be more appropriate. The hood clearance is almost nonexistent above the manifolds, a couple of bulges will cure that. I think 500HP from a turbo HE would be possible with modern EFI and minimal mods. Drop CR to 9.0:1. You could use a de-compression plate although I am not a fan of these as they reduce the squish area. I would look at removing some metal from around the valves to deshroud both exhaust and to a lesser extent inlet. Remove enough to set the CR at 9:1.
I don't think you need to go to the expense of COP (coil on plug) a good distributorless system would be good enough, MS have coil packs and ignition drivers. You can install the ignition drivers in a remote box to drive the V12, so you don't even need to go EDIS.
